" An immaculately presented 3 bed semi detached house that has undergone a full scheme of modernisation and must be viewed to be fully appreciated. Situated on Leechmere Road the property commands a much sought after location providing easy access to local shops, schools and amenities as well and Sunderland City Centre. The property benefits from Gas Central Heating, Double Glazing, new fitted kitchen, new bathroom suite, new carpets and many extras of note. The internal accommodation briefly comprises of Entrance Porch, Inner Hall, Living Room, Kitchen / Dining Room, Utility and to the First Floor, 3 Bedrooms and Bathroom. Externally there is a front garden and driveway leading to house and garage and to the rear garden with decking area, lawn and path that enjoys an open aspect to the rear.
